      <description>&lt;P&gt;Hello.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;I upgraded to Marshmallow today and I like it so far. One thing I've noticed is that my Wifi isn't turning off when the phone is locked and in sleep mode like it used to in Lollipop. In my phone settings, 'Keep Wifi on during sleep' is set to 'NEVER' – and yet it's staying active. Why is this? It's draining my battery unnecessarily.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;</description>
